.hero{position:relative;height:100vh;min-height:600px;display:flex;flex-direction:column;align-items:center;justify-content:center;overflow:hidden}.hero-bg,.hero-grid{position:absolute;inset:0}.hero-grid{background-image:linear-gradient(rgba(10,158,138,.06) 1px,transparent 0),linear-gradient(90deg,rgba(10,158,138,.06) 1px,transparent 0);background-size:60px 60px;-webkit-mask-image:radial-gradient(ellipse 80% 80% at 50% 50%,#000 40%,transparent 100%);mask-image:radial-gradient(ellipse 80% 80% at 50% 50%,#000 40%,transparent 100%)}.hero-orb{position:absolute;border-radius:50%;filter:blur(80px);animation:pulse 6s ease-in-out infinite}.orb1{width:400px;height:400px;background:rgba(10,158,138,.12);top:-100px;right:-100px;animation-delay:0s}.orb2{width:300px;height:300px;background:rgba(201,168,76,.06);bottom:-50px;left:-80px;animation-delay:3s}@keyframes pulse{0%,to{transform:scale(1);opacity:.6}50%{transform:scale(1.15);opacity:1}}.hero-content{position:relative;text-align:center;padding:0 20px;animation:fadeUp 1s ease both}.hero-eyebrow{display:inline-flex;align-items:center;gap:10px;font-size:11px;font-weight:600;letter-spacing:3px;text-transform:uppercase;color:#06b2a6;margin-bottom:24px}.hero-eyebrow:after,.hero-eyebrow:before{content:"";width:30px;height:1px;background:#06b2a6;opacity:.5}.hero-title{font-size:clamp(2.4rem,5vw,4rem);font-weight:700;line-height:1.15;color:#000;margin-bottom:12px}.hero-title span{background:linear-gradient(135deg,#06b2a6,#c9a84c);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.hero-sub{font-size:1rem;color:#8a9bab;max-width:480px;margin:0 auto 40px;line-height:1.7}.hero-cta{display:inline-flex;align-items:center;gap:8px;padding:13px 32px;background:transparent;border:1.5px solid #06b2a6;border-radius:50px;color:#06b2a6;font-size:.85rem;font-weight:500;letter-spacing:1px;text-transform:uppercase;cursor:pointer;transition:all .3s;text-decoration:none}.hero-cta:hover{background:#06b2a6;color:#fff;box-shadow:0 0 30px rgba(10,158,138,.3);transform:translateY(-2px)}.hero-scroll{position:absolute;bottom:40px;left:50%;transform:translateX(-50%);display:flex;flex-direction:column;align-items:center;gap:8px;color:#8a9bab;font-size:11px;letter-spacing:2px;text-transform:uppercase;animation:bounce 2s ease-in-out infinite}.scroll-line{width:1px;height:40px;background:linear-gradient(180deg,#06b2a6,transparent)}@keyframes bounce{0%,to{transform:translateX(-50%) translateY(0)}50%{transform:translateX(-50%) translateY(6px)}}@keyframes fadeU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.section{max-width:1100px;margin:0 auto;padding:80px 24px}.section-label{font-size:11px;letter-spacing:3px;text-transform:uppercase;color:#06b2a6;margin-bottom:16px;margin-top:0}.section-label,.section-title{text-align:center;font-weight:600}.section-title{font-size:clamp(1.6rem,3vw,2.4rem);color:#000;margin-bottom:48px;line-height:1.3}.section-title em{font-style:italic;color:#06b2a6}.exchanges-grid{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:20px;gap:20px;margin-bottom:0}.exchange-card{position:relative;background:hsla(0,0%,100%,.04);border:1px solid rgba(10,158,138,.2);border-radius:16px;padding:32px 24px;text-align:center;transition:all .4s cubic-bezier(.23,1,.32,1);overflow:hidden;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.exchange-card:before{content:"";position:absolute;inset:0;background:linear-gradient(135deg,rgba(10,158,138,.1),transparent);opacity:0;transition:opacity .3s}.exchange-card:hover{border-color:#06b2a6;transform:translateY(-6px);box-shadow:0 20px 60px rgba(10,158,138,.15),0 0 0 1px rgba(10,158,138,.3)}.exchange-card:hover:before{opacity:1}.exchange-abbr{display:inline-block;font-size:2rem;font-weight:700;color:#06b2a6;margin-bottom:8px;letter-spacing:2px}.exchange-name{font-size:.8rem;color:#8a9bab;letter-spacing:.5px}.exchange-dot{position:absolute;top:16px;right:16px;width:8px;height:8px;border-radius:50%;background:#06b2a6;box-shadow:0 0 8px #06b2a6;animation:blink 2s ease-in-out infinite}@keyframes blink{0%,to{opacity:1}50%{opacity:.3}}.divider{max-width:1100px;margin:0 auto;height:1px;background:linear-gradient(90deg,transparent,rgba(10,158,138,.2),transparent)}.disclosures-section{background:#f5f5f5;padding:100px 24px;position:relative;overflow:hidden}.disclosures-section:before{content:"";position:absolute;top:0;left:50%;transform:translateX(-50%);width:600px;height:2px;background:linear-gradient(90deg,transparent,#06b2a6,transparent)}.disc-bg-text{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-size:18vw;font-weight:700;color:rgba(10,158,138,.025);white-space:nowrap;p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.disc-inner{position:relative;max-width:1100px;margin:0 auto}.disc-header{display:flex;align-items:flex-end;justify-content:space-between;margin-bottom:60px;gap:20px}.disc-title{margin:0;font-size:clamp(1.8rem,3.5vw,2.8rem);font-weight:700;color:#000;line-height:1.2}.disc-title span{color:#06b2a6}.disc-sub{font-size:.85rem;color:#000;margin-top:8px;margin-bottom:0}.disc-badge{flex-shrink:0;padding:8px 20px;border:1px solid rgba(201,168,76,.3);border-radius:50px;color:#c9a84c;font-size:11px;font-weight:600;letter-spacing:2px;text-transform:uppercase;background:rgba(201,168,76,.05)}.menu-grid{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:2px;gap:2px;background:rgba(10,158,138,.2);border-radius:20px;overflow:hidden;border:1px solid rgba(10,158,138,.2)}.menu-item{background:transparent;padding:28px 24px;display:flex;align-items:center;gap:16px;cursor:pointer;transition:all .3s;position:relative;overflow:hidden}.menu-item:after{content:"";position:absolute;left:0;top:0;bottom:0;width:3px;background:#06b2a6;transform:scaleY(0);transition:transform .3s}.menu-item:hover{background:rgba(10,158,138,.08)}.menu-item:hover:after{transform:scaleY(1)}.menu-icon{width:40px;height:40px;border-radius:10px;background:rgba(10,158,138,.1);border:1px solid rgba(10,158,138,.2);display:flex;align-items:center;justify-content:center;font-size:1rem;flex-shrink:0;transition:all .3s}.menu-item:hover .menu-icon{background:rgba(10,158,138,.2);border-color:#06b2a6;box-shadow:0 0 16px rgba(10,158,138,.2)}.menu-name{font-size:.88rem;font-weight:500;color:#000;line-height:1.3;transition:color .3s}.menu-item:hover .menu-name{color:#06b2a6}.menu-arrow{margin-left:auto;color:#8a9bab;font-size:.75rem;opacity:0;transform:translateX(-6px);transition:all .3s}.menu-item:hover .menu-arrow{opacity:1;transform:translateX(0)}.menu-grid a{text-decoration:none}@media (max-width:768px){.exchanges-grid{gap:12px}.exchanges-grid,.menu-grid{grid-template-columns:1fr}.disc-header{flex-direction:column;align-items:flex-start}.hero-title{font-size:2rem}}@media (max-width:900px){.exchanges-grid{grid-template-columns:1fr 1fr}.exchanges-grid .exchange-card:last-child{grid-column:span 2}.menu-grid{grid-template-columns:repeat(2,1fr)}}